
Fig. 8. CM-Der inhibits secretion of multiple members of the TGFß superfamily. Oocytes were injected with synthetic mRNA encoding epitope tagged proAct-Xnr2 (HA tagged), proAct-Derrière (Flag tagged) or BMP4 either alone or in combination with CM-Der. Injected oocytes were cultured in the presence of [35S]methionine and the supernatants and lysates analyzed by immunoprecipitation. Supernatants from oocytes expressing proAct-Xnr2, proAct-Derrière or BMP4 alone contain bands corresponding to the predicted sizes of the mature ligands, while the lysates also contain higher molecular weight unprocessed precursor proteins (lanes 1-3). CM-Der (tagged with the Glu-Glu epitope) is seen only in oocyte lysates and in its presence no mature Xnr2, Derrière or BMP4 ligands are detected in the supernatants (lanes 4-7). Unprocessed precursor proteins are still detected in oocyte lysates. Asterisks indicate unprocessed BMP4; arrowheads indicate mature Xnr2 and Derrière ligands.
